Transaction ad66bfbc6f5a962e3c89bd5a08798eff9b15f26b4e7de5a027204bb8a117d1fb

1 Input
2 Outputs
  • ad66bfbc6f5a962e3c89bd5a08798eff9b15f26b4e7de5a027204bb8a117d1fb:0
  • value  3306292
    address  3F8Ua71VTKc7SehJwEo5fuTGzw4T1m8HTw
  • ad66bfbc6f5a962e3c89bd5a08798eff9b15f26b4e7de5a027204bb8a117d1fb:1
  • value  22510390
    address  3ABE4BZkwv2ubYYGhUtNxL57gMwenUEuNW